Subject outline

Students will be introduced to the chemical principles that are required to understand the action and behaviours of a drug compound. The main areas of study include an introduction to the chemistry and nomenclature of carbohydrates, lipids, steroids and heterocyclic compounds and some of their reactions. This unit will provide an understanding of how the chemical structure and behaviour of drug molecules relate to the activity of drugs in biological systems, and how this knowledge can be used to devise strategies for drug design and principles of drug structure-activity relationships (SAR and QSAR), drug-receptor interactions and drugs metabolism. This unit will also contain a computer based practical component.

Intended Learning Outcomes

01. Apply understanding of the chemistry of important biological molecules such as carbohydrates, lipids, steroids and heterocyclic molecules to medicinal products.
02. Apply advanced understanding of the chemistry of organic compounds and its impact on syntheses to enhance drug efficacy.
03. Use the major concepts and language of pharmaceutical and medicinal chemistry correctly.
04. Determine likely routes of administration through recognition of drug structures, identification and prediction of likely metabolic and elimination pathways, solubility and metabolism.
05. Devise strategies for drug design and principles of drug structure-activity relationships (SAR and QSAR).
